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
229999 5184803 41565244595 91703 0938402
8076480319 7614
8076480319 7614
339204562 8465227121 447 624453
All about undefined
Interested in learning more?
8076480319 7614
339204562 8465227121 447 624453
See more
944564 851
834 465580768 487 6849783
See more
99 12
39 77314816047 635 047
See more